c235b05e1d feat: add file tree upload progress
Users need a visible upload path from the explorer itself, not only drag and
 drop behavior with no progress feedback. Routing picker and drop uploads
 through one XHR-backed hook keeps progress, validation, refresh, and success
 counts consistent for every upload source.

The 200MB limit is mirrored in the client, multer, and nginx template so large
 uploads fail predictably instead of being blocked by whichever layer sees the
 request first. The server also returns explicit requested and uploaded counts
 so partial or multi-file batches can render accurate status text.

const uploadFormDataWithProgress = (
projectId: string,
formData: FormData,
onProgress: (progress: number) => void,
) =>
new Promise<UploadResponse>((resolve, reject) => {
const xhr = new XMLHttpRequest();
xhr.open('POST', `/api/projects/${encodeURIComponent(projectId)}/files/upload`);
const token = localStorage.getItem('auth-token');
if (!IS_PLATFORM && token) {
xhr.setRequestHeader('Authorization', `Bearer ${token}`);
}
xhr.upload.onprogress = (event) => {
if (!event.lengthComputable) {
return;
}
// Keep 100% for the server response so the UI can distinguish transfer
// completion from the final write/refresh step.
onProgress(Math.min(99, Math.round((event.loaded / event.total) * 100)));
};
xhr.onload = () => {
const refreshedToken = xhr.getResponseHeader('X-Refreshed-Token');
if (refreshedToken) {
localStorage.setItem('auth-token', refreshedToken);
}
const payload = parseUploadResponse(xhr);
if (xhr.status >= 200 && xhr.status < 300) {
resolve(payload);
return;
}
reject(new Error(payload.error || payload.message || `Upload failed with status ${xhr.status}`));
};
xhr.onerror = () => reject(new Error('Upload failed. Check your connection and try again.'));
xhr.onabort = () => reject(new Error('Upload canceled.'));
xhr.send(formData);
});
